HEP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2017 in Review
96 of the 4,012 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Holly Energy Partners, L.P. (HEP) for Q3 2017, worth a combined $1.05B — up 8.2% from $967M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 16 funds closed out of HEP and 6 opened new positions — a net loss of 10 holders — while 39 trimmed existing stakes and 25 added.
The largest buyer was ALPS Advisors, opening a new position worth an estimated $112M. The largest seller was Tortoise Capital Advisors, cutting an estimated $43.9M.
